Lalonde said Wednesday. feetnext Tuesday according in the East because of: ‘Lalonde said officials are . to. pricing agreements Pipeline-transmiésion costs. - studying what: changes will reached with: the wester . “Provinces. “While a lowering ‘ot the The gas-pricing program, ’ wasestablished to en-. ‘courage conversion from oil: ~ Roman Catholic sect endures harsh times MONTREAL (CP) — Since Gaston Tremblay folinded the - North American branch of the Apostles of Infinite Love in the early 1960s, the breakaway Roman Catholic sect-has | been wracked by legal battles, by a disastrous fire, and by accusations of child abuse and homosexuality. But the sect has endured... At Apostles’. headquarters, ‘the sprawling Magnificat - -: ‘monastery near the Laurentian village of St. Jovite, the . numbér of. residents peaked at about 500 adults’ and. 150 ~ children in 1976, when an unexplained fire destroyed part of the buildings. Arson was allegedly the cause, but no arres{s |. were made. Sect spokesman Sister Michelle says about 400 adults and 35 children remain at the monastery, Outside, the sect claims several: thousand . followers connected . with the 7 "> Apostles’ scattered “missions.” Locations of the outside missions include Guatemala, , Puerto Rico, Guadeloupe, the Dominican Republic, Florida, upper New. Collin’s attacks on the chureh establishment and liberalization found fertile ground in Québec; a devout Roman Catholic society in the. throes of profound changes’ ‘Imown as the Quiet Resvolution. But in 1963, shortly before his death, the French leader dismissed Tremblay after welfare investigators found that children of the disciples at the. St. Jovite retreat: were threatened and badly fed. With Collin's death, Tremblay assumed the title of pope, A bearded, lanky figure, Tremblay wears the brown robes and skullcap of the male members of the seet and isa fiery — ‘speaker. The defector says: “Father. Jean is like the God of the monastery: His words are sacred. It’s a tactic.” ‘Adults tending children at the monastery are forbidden to hit them, she Bays, but admits frayed nerves can sometimes ; Disease causes miscarriages. - HALIFAX (CP) — The transmission of a | disease which causes spontaneous abortions and stillbirths has baffled the _ Sharpest minds of the medical profession for years, but a sleuth from Georgia says luck helped solve the riddle of of. _ an outbreak of listeriosis in Nova Scotia. ‘Dr. Walter Schlech, called upon during an epidemic two. years ago, recounted In an interview how the illness of a tourist finally led him to the source — cabbage grown in contaminated sheep manure. The disease, found mainly in cows and. sheep and com- monly knowr-as “‘circting didease or “the staggers”, . rarely affects humans, But in'1981, 41 cases were reported... ms Five resulted In spontaneous abortion and four in. stillbir- ths; Six of 23 seriously ill infants died. The Centre for Disease Control: in Atlanta, Ga., bent ' epldemlologiat: ‘Sehlech to Halifax to join in an, intensive study of possible causes. “It was my turn to investigate. an outbreak in the field," said Schlech, now an assistant professor of ‘medicine at - Dalhousie University in Halifax... : we The bacteria of listeriosis ia frequently found in. ‘gol, water and yegetation.* | poisoning. Susceptibility increases during pregnancy and the result can be a -sttibirth, abortion or a devastating septic illness in the newborn infant, 10: Schlech, working with a provincial. epidemiologist and .two members of the Dalhousie faculty of medicine, sur- veyed the affected people, taking details of medical, oc- . cupational, travel, gardening activities nd exposure {6 5 winds by the site. For. government: inspectors ‘to check the - - animals, A food survey produced ho common factor in the diet of affected adults. - The admiaaion of an eldery’ -Ontario vacationer to a - > Halifax’ hospital provided the luck that Schlech said Is part of most: investigations. Tests on the patient revealed listeria ‘in his sputum and - _ blood. He was able to provide details of his diet during the 10 days he had been .in the city. He: and. his wife. had prepared their own meals and refrigerated ‘the leftovers, including a brand of coleslay made of carrots and cabbage. “The bacteria, Listeria monocytogenes, was isolated from 7 ’ the commercially prepared coleslaw, ‘distributed cnly to supermarkets in the three’ Marititne provinces, The . - listeriosis epidemic had also been confined | to the Maritimes. Sehtech “visited the ‘plant where: ‘the: ‘coleslaw was processed and determined the contamination had occ _ earlier, possibly at‘the farm level.
